Senior Childcare Practitioner – Children's Residential Home

Location: Sunderland
Provision: Children’s Residential Home (Ages 7-17, EBD & Mild Learning Difficulties)
Hours: 8 am to 8 pm and Occasional 8 am to 8pm + sleep in
Salary: £27,144 - £36,192 base8-10 sleep-ins/month (£52 per sleep)
Potential take-home: Up to £41,184 per annum

About the Role

Are you an experienced Residential Support Worker looking to take the next step in your career? Or are you already a Senior Practitioner seeking a new challenge?

There are currently 5 vacancies across multip homes in Sunderland.

As a Senior Childcare Practitioner, you will play a vital role in supporting children and young people with Emotional and Behavioural Difficulties (EBD) and Mild Learning Difficulties (MLD). You will be a role model, mentor, and key worker, ensuring the best possible care and outcomes for the children.

This is an exciting opportunity to join a well-established and growing organisation with a strong Ofsted “Good” track record and a commitment to achieving Outstanding ratings.

What We’re Looking For
  • Level 3 Diploma in Residential Childcare (or equivalent – see below)
  • Experience working with children in residential care or similar settings
  • Ability to manage challenging behaviours and create a nurturing environment
  • Full UK Driving Licence (Essential)
  • Fluency in English (with the ability to understand UK dialects)
  • Minimum Age: 22/23 (in line with regulatory requirements)

Alternative Qualifications Considered:
If you hold a Level 3 Diploma in Adult Social Care, we will consider your application if you can demonstrate experience working with children.

Key Responsibilities
  • Support young people with emotional and behavioural needs in a residential setting
  • Act as a positive role model and key worker, helping children develop essential life skills
  • Promote a nurturing and supportive environment that encourages growth and independence
  • Contribute to care planning, behaviour management, and safeguarding processes
  • Support less experienced staff and lead shifts as required
